Hundreds of hospitality workers at an off-Strip casino will walk off the job for the second time this year after employer Virgin Hotels and Culinary Local 226 leadership failed to agree on a new multi-year contract Thursday night.
Last week, Culinary set a 5 a.m. Friday strike deadline to press Virgin management to get a deal done one week before the Las Vegas Grand Prix.
Virgin said it tried to address Culinary’s concerns about a lack of wage increases in the first three years of the contract.
